Package: evolution-plugins Version: 3.16.3-1 Severity: important When using the face plugin to configuring an image, a Face header is added to outgoing email. For common sizes of images this results in lines that are too long.
RFC 2822 section 2.1.1 specifies the maximum line length to be 998.
